    What’s Behind Major Rise in Heart Failure Deaths?

    Could 3, 2024 — People are dying of coronary heart failure immediately at a better price than they did in 1999, reversing years of progress in decreasing the demise price. 

    That’s the stark message of a new JAMA Cardiology examine, which finds that the present mortality price from coronary heart failure is 3% larger than it was 25 years in the past. Based mostly on information from demise certificates, the examine says, the mortality price fell considerably from 1999 to 2009, then plateaued for a number of years earlier than sharply rising from 2012 to 2019. Through the pandemic years of 2020 and 2021, the most recent 12 months for which information is on the market, coronary heart failure deaths accelerated.

    “These information are placing,” stated Veronique Roger, MD, MPH, chief of the epidemiology and group well being department of the Nationwide Coronary heart, Lung, and Blood Institute. “They actually represent an pressing name for motion to reverse this development.”

    Roger, who was not concerned within the examine, famous that through the 2000s, the mortality price from heart problems declined and that now it has leveled off, largely due to the burst in deaths attributed to coronary heart failure. “This paper reveals that not solely are we don’t make progress, however our good points are being eroded. So it’s a serious deal.”

    In response to the Nationwide Institutes of Well being, about 6.7 million People have coronary heart failure immediately. That’s only a snapshot in time, in fact: About 1 in 4 People will develop coronary heart failure throughout their lifetimes, the NIH stated. About half of these with the situation die inside 5 years after analysis.

    People who find themselves 65 or older have a far larger probability of dying of coronary heart failure than youthful individuals do. Nevertheless, the relative improve within the demise price was most marked amongst youthful People, based on the examine. Amongst individuals youthful than 45, there was a ninefold rise in coronary heart failure deaths from 2012 to 2021, and there was virtually a fourfold improve amongst individuals aged 45-64.

    Comorbidities Result in Coronary heart Failure

    Within the view of examine co-author Marat Fudim, MD, an affiliate professor of cardiology at Duke College in Durham, NC, the rise in coronary heart failure deaths amongst youthful individuals might be associated to the truth that weight problems and diabetes have grow to be extra prevalent amongst younger adults. It’s not stunning, he stated, that an rising variety of individuals with these issues develop coronary heart failure in center age.

    In any other case, he stated, “the reversal of [heart failure mortality] traits appears to have hit women and men and the completely different races in a really comparable vogue. It didn’t discriminate in that or in rural versus city residents. Whereas there have been stark variations between racial teams and between rural and concrete in coronary heart failure mortality charges, the reversal development could be very comparable amongst all these teams.” 

    “What we see in practices is that comorbidities drive coronary heart failure,” stated Fudim, whose personal cardiology follow specializes on this situation. “Coronary heart failure isn’t a single illness drawback. Often, coronary heart failure sufferers have weight problems, diabetes, cardiac artery illness, hyperlipidemia — all these illnesses are driving coronary heart failure, which results in mortality.”

    The rise in coronary heart failure mortality predated the COVID-19 pandemic, however COVID accelerated the rise in deaths from this situation. From 2012 to 2019, the common annual share change in mortality was 1.82%; throughout 2020 and 2021, it was 7.06%.

    Fudim stated there have been two causes for this. First, sufferers who had been hospitalized for a COVID-related pneumonia had a roughly 20% larger probability of creating coronary heart failure than did different individuals, after adjusting for his or her well being standing. As well as, COVID worsened well being disparities associated to race and earnings stage, and it made the well being system concentrate on COVID-related care moderately than on coronary heart failure prevention or administration.

    Elements in Mortality Charge Enhance

    A co-author of an earlier paper that confirmed a rise within the price of coronary heart failure deaths agreed that COVID was “like throwing gasoline on the fireplace” of coronary heart failure mortality. 

    Sadiya S. Khan, MD, the Magerstadt Professor of Cardiovascular Epidemiology on the Feinberg College of Drugs at Northwestern College in Chicago, additionally agreed that the rise within the variety of middle-aged individuals dying of this situation might be associated to comorbidities they developed earlier in life. Khan added kidney illness to the record of potential issues associated to demise from coronary heart failure. And, she stated, she can also be seeing earlier onset of coronary heart failure. 

    Khan’s analysis group revealed a paper displaying that the mortality price for coronary heart illness from hardening of the arteries — often known as ischemic coronary heart illness, which frequently results in coronary heart assaults — declined at the same time as the guts failure demise price rose. She attributes this primarily to there being higher therapies for the underlying coronary heart illness.

    “For ischemic coronary heart illness, there was lots of progress in efficient therapies, notably associated to stenting and efficient lipid-lowering therapies with statins and a few new therapies. We haven’t seen the identical progress for coronary heart failure.”

    One other issue that may have contributed to the elevated mortality price is the prevalence of coronary heart failure. If extra individuals develop coronary heart failure, extra of them will die of it. Then again, stated Roger and Fudim, a better demise price would possibly end result from sufferers with coronary heart failure being sicker than they was once, even with out elevated prevalence. Fudim stated the information present the guts failure price is pretty flat however progressively ticking up. 

    The place Did We Go Mistaken?

    Khan’s 2019 examine prompt that the sooner decline in heart problems deaths mirrored the success of insurance policies geared toward rising management of blood stress and ldl cholesterol, together with larger charges of individuals quitting smoking and efficient remedy use. 

    “Nevertheless, the prevalence of weight problems and diabetes has elevated dramatically, the decline in general CVD demise charges has stalled, and coronary heart failure-related CVD mortality charges are rising,” the paper stated.

    If that’s the case most of the proper issues had been being carried out, why did the guts failure mortality development reverse?

    Roger doesn’t blame docs, who proceed to do the best issues, in her view.

    “What we haven’t carried out proper is our failure to regulate weight problems and diabetes. Diabetes travels with weight problems, so if we focus solely on weight problems, the alternatives that you just and I and everybody make after we eat are usually not within the physician’s workplace,” Roger stated. 

    “I feel we’ve carried out one of the best we may with the issues which can be inside our management,” she stated. “However that’s offset by the traits in weight problems, that are associated to the consumption of ultra-processed meals, sugar-sweetened drinks, and so forth.”

    Fudim, in distinction, believes the well being system is no less than partly responsible for the reversal of the guts failure mortality development. Partly due to the shortages in major care, he stated, entry to care is restricted in lots of areas, prevention and continual care are being under-emphasized, and a few coronary heart failure sufferers are usually not getting the care they want.

    Roger agreed. She cited the considerably larger coronary heart failure demise price amongst Black individuals as proof that “difficulties in accessing the well being care system and the standard of well being care each play a task.”

    Then again, she stated, well being methods have positioned a precedence on enhancing the care of coronary heart failure sufferers, partly due to Medicare incentives. The rise within the price of coronary heart failure deaths, regardless of all of those efforts, she stated, ought to be “an pressing wake-up name. There are new avenues of analysis, prevention, and scientific follow that ought to be synergized to deal with or mitigate this development as a result of we will’t let it go on like this.”
